This is on the edge of the developed North side for that reason it's quite other than Friday nights when there's a club night at the roof. If you arrive Friday you'll hear it even blocks away but you would be so tired anyway it's ok. Rest of the time is quiet and lovely as it's not as much traffic.
Super convenient wirh Selecto super market close by and a very nice bakery right across the street. Calle 38 was also by far the easiest to walk up and down between 5th and the local hub 30th for a real authentic experience.
If you want do the beach club they are associated with Martina beach club so you don't have to pay for the chair. Only credits for drinks and food.
The hotel also gives you beach towels if you want to just go to the beach. Which is super convienient with public access again on 38th. Just grab a towel and head down after 2 as there's large shade by the entrance left and you don't need to rent umbrella. Also at the entrance is an OXXO so you just need to buy a cooler bag to keep your drinks cold.
Note about playa. At the ado station you'll pay about 150 peso for taxi. Or use the radio PDC app. But you'll have to go a block away and put in an address of where you are to get pick up as it isn't allow to pick up at the main roads. It's 75pesos instead to travel between ado station to this hotel.
Over we like the hotel because it was quiet. It's a bit far if you want to be in the center of the action but we didn't care to do that much
